Trip Overview

The bus between Nottingham (Station) and Queen's Medical Centre takes 6 min. The bus runs at least 2 times per hour from Nottingham (Station) to Queen's Medical Centre. The journey time may be longer on weekends and holidays; use the search form on this page to search for a specific travel date.

Nottingham (Station) to Queen's Medical Centre bus times

Buses run every 30 minutes between Nottingham (Station) and Queen's Medical Centre. The earliest departure is at 2:08 AM at night, and the last departure from Nottingham (Station) is at 10:08 PM which arrives into Queen's Medical Centre at 10:14 PM. All services run direct with no transfers required, and take on average 6 min. The schedules shown below are for the next available departures.

What companies run services between Nottingham (Station), England and Queen's Medical Centre, England?

Trent Barton operates a bus from Broad Marsh Bus Station to Gregory Street every 15 minutes. Tickets cost £3–4 and the journey takes 6 min.
